Jake to have scan
Jake Fairbrother is to have a scan on his troublesome knee injury which has kept him out for nearly two months.
During the Umbro FA Trophy victory over Southport, Fairbrother tore some fibres in his knee.

He was rested and has recently returned to training. However, he is still being troubled by the injury.

John McGinay said: " We expected the injury to have cleared up by now but he is still suffering pain. He can run and kick a ball, but the problems are when he turns.

"Jake has never really had a long term injury and he needs to have his mind settled by having a scan on his knee. He is desperate to play."
